ON THIS DAY in 2019 — Arsenal signed William Saliba.
A teenage defender from Saint-Étienne with the posture of a veteran and the promise of something rare. It took time — loans, questions, waiting — but when he finally stepped into the red and white, he didn’t walk in. He arrived.
Since then?
The fastest player to reach 50 Premier League wins in Arsenal history.
The first outfield Gunner ever to play every single minute of a PL campaign.
And now, 100 games in, his record looks like a defender sculpted in marble:
◉ 100 appearances
◉ 68 wins
◉ 41 clean sheets
◉ 6 goals
